Anmelden

View Full Version : CPYF von Satzlänge 132 in 80



LS400
08-06-10, 14:03
Hallo zusammen,

ist es irgendwie "einfach" möglich beim kopieren einen Zeilenumbruch statt einen Zeilenabschnitt zu erreichen?

Mit CPYF (FMTOPT *CVTSRC) wird jedenfalls abgeschnitten.

Grüße

Pikachu
08-06-10, 14:05
Wenn der CPYF aus einem Datensatz zwei Datensätze erzeugen soll, dann geht das meines Wissens nach nicht.

LS400
08-06-10, 14:10
Also bleibt nur ein zB. RPG welches die Problemstellung umsetzt?!....

Grüße

Fuerchau
08-06-10, 14:33
Es geht über einen Umweg:
CPYFRMSTMF PF->IFS
CPYFRMSTMF IFS->PF

Hier kannst du durch die Satztrenner *CRLF/*FIXED erreichen, dass
a) bei *CRLF 132 in 80 + 52
b) bei *FIXED alles in 80
aufgeteilt wird.

Versuchen kannst du auch CPYFRMSTMF PF1->PF2